
Ladyjacks Hit the Road Against Pair of Louisiana Opponents
1/15/2025 3:30:00 PM | Women's Basketball
Stephen F. Austin vs McNeese State University
Date: Thursday, January 16th
Time: 6:00 p.m. CT
Live Stream: ESPN+
Arena: Legacy Center
All-Time Series: SFA Leads 52-13
LAKE CHARLES, LA.- The Stephen F. Austin Ladyjacks women's basketball team (13-4, 3-3) continue their three-game road trip as they travel to Lake Charles, Louisiana to square off with the McNeese State University Cowgirls (7-9, 2-3).
Ladyjacks at a Glance:
The Ladyjacks will be looking to get back in the win column on Thursday night in Lake Charles after dropping their most recent game in a heart-breaking 77-74 loss to Lamar as Faith Blackstone's game-tying three-point attempt came up just short as it hit the front of the rim as time expired. Despite the loss, the Ladyjacks offense continues to excel as they tallied their sixth game in their last seven with at least 70 points, while boasting the best offense in the Southland as they average a healthy 80.6 points/game this season. The Ladyjacks will be looking to continue their pesky play away from the Sawmill as they hold a 4-3 road record, while looking to tally their fourth conference win of the year.
Cowgirls at a Glance:
The McNeese State Cowgirls will continue their three-game homestand looking to also get back in the win column as they dropped their homestand opener to Nicholls 60-47. The Cowgirls have still been a solid team at home this season despite the loss as they have posted a 4-3 home record and posted point totals of 99 and 105 in their first two home games of the season. The Cowgirls non-conference schedule was no small task as they faced off with Utah, BYU, and Oklahoma State, while tallying their first conference wins of the year with wins over East Texas A&M and Houston Christian before their most recent loss to Nicholls.
Scouting Report-Ladyjacks:
Faith Blackstone and Ashlyn Traylor-Walker have been the definition of consistency for the Ladyjacks recently as Blackstone has recorded double-digit point scoring efforts in seven of her last eight games while Traylor-Walker has recorded double-digit point outings in six of her last seven games as well. Avery VanSickle has been equally consistent for the 'Jacks especially from beyond the arc as she has made at least one three-pointer in nine of her last 10 games. Defensively, Ashlyn Traylor-Walker has been a force to be reckoned with as she has recorded at least one steal in every game this season for SFA.
Scouting Report-Cowgirls:
Paris Guillory has been the MVP of the Cowgirls offense as she leads the team averaging 16.3 points/game while draining 19 three-pointers. Mireia Yespes has been a workhorse for McNeese as she has started all 16 games this year and has scored a team-high 136 points. Kiayra Ellis has led the defensive effort for McNeese as she has blocked a team-leading 21 blocks while adding on eight steals.
Series:
Thursday's conference road matchup will feature the 66th all-time meeting between these two iconic Southland opponents with SFA leading the series 52-13. Thursday will mark the first time SFA has traveled to Lake Charles since 2019, as the Ladyjacks have won the previous six meetings between the two schools including the most recent one in 2019 when they posted a 82-51 win over the Cowgirls at the Sawmill.
Stephen F. Austin vs Nicholls University
Date: Saturday, January 18th
Time: 1:00 p.m. CT
Live Stream: ESPN+
Arena: David R. Stopher Gymnasium
All-Time Series: SFA Leads 20-6
THIBODAUX, LA.- The Stephen F. Austin Ladyjacks women's basketball team (13-4, 3-3) close out their three-game road trip in Thibodaux as they get set to duel the Nicholls University Colonels (10-5, 3-3).
Colonels at a Glance:
The Nicholls University Colonels will look to extend their current two-game winning streak as they return home for a short two-game homestand. The Colonels open the homestand against the Lamar University Cardinals on Thursday before hosting SFA on Saturday to close out the homestand. Nicholls has been no stranger to win streaks this year as they have posted four-game and three-game win streaks to go along with their current two-game win streak. The Colonels have been a tough team to beat on their home court this season as they have posted a 4-1 home record and have scored over 60 points in four of their five home games.
Scouting Report-Colonels:
Tanita Swift spearheads the Colonels offensive attack as her 15.9 points/game average leads the team and ranks her second in the Southland this year. Swift has also been an enforcer on defense as she leads the team in steals with 31. Deonna Brister and Britiya Curtis have formed a solid shooting duo from beyond the arc for Nicholls as both have made over 20 three-pointers.
Series:
Saturday's road matchup for the Ladyjacks will mark the 27th all-time meeting between these two Southland foes with the Ladyjacks leading the all-time series 20-6. SFA has won six of the last seven meetings between the two schools including the most recent one in 2020 when the defeated the Colonels 78-61 on their home court.
